We’ve all heard the song line: If it ain’t broke, don’t fix it

But what about when it’s broke? It’s been broke for a while. And it needs to be fixed.

I wish I could say that fixing the problem is the obvious solution. But from what I’ve seen, that’s a lie: if it were obvious, everyone would be doing it.

Instead, people shy away from fixing a problem and instead find a way to just get by for a while. They patch the hole. But the hole is still there. And it’s only a matter of time before you fall into it again.

And it angers me when I know I’m being ordered to patch a hole and not fix it. Because I know that soon I will be patching the hole again. And again. When you patch holes, you’re only wasting time. And effort. And jeopardizing satisfaction.

Please, if it’s broken, then fix it!
